Getting too much fuel

Still getting my intro to TBI tech,gotta question....I'm getting too much fuel and a high idle. I've eliminated any vacuum leaks,I'm wondering if there are any sensors that would cause this,or if I just need to put a rebuild on it? Any suggestions would be appreciated....thx

Re: Getting too much fuel

WHAT VEHICLE? Any codes?

HOW do you know you're getting "too much fuel"? What is the O2 sensor showing for voltage and cross-counts?

WHAT does your scan-tool show for actual idle speed and commanded idle speed? Does the IAC work properly?
